London, July 14 (UNI) Emirates airline has blasted one of the world’s busiest airports for its “incompetence” in failing to handle a surge in passengers, media reports said. The Dubai-based airline on Thursday slammed demands made by London’s Heathrow airport earlier this week that carriers stop selling any more tickets for this summer, CNN reported.

The airline, which operates six daily flights from Heathrow, has rejected the new limits and called them “entirely unreasonable and unacceptable”, CNN reported. Heathrow, like other airports, has struggled to cope with a bounce back in travelers after two years of pandemic re- restrictions and staff cuts. The airport said on Tuesday that it would cap daily passenger numbers at 100,000 until September 11. “(London Heath- row) chose not to act, not to plan, not to invest. Now faced with an ‘armageddon’ situation due to their incompetence and non-action, they are pushing the entire burden of costs and the scramble.
